Citations
3 citations on file for this inspection.
1910.147 C04 I
- Issued
- Dec 18, 2014
- Abate by
- Dec 31, 2014
- Penalty
- Initial $7,000 · Current $5,600 Reduced
General-duty citation text
29 CFR 1910.147(c)(4)(i): Procedures were not developed, documented and utilized for the control of potentially hazardous energy when employees were engaged in activities covered by this section: At 6415 Richmond Ave. Houston, TX; on or about August 06, 2014, the employer did not developed and utilized specific procedures for the control of hazardous energy when employees are required to perform maintenance on a Komatsu Track Hoe. Model #: PC228USLC. Serial #: UNK, exposing employees to struck by hazards.

1910.147 C07 I
- Issued
- Dec 18, 2014
- Abate by
- Dec 31, 2014
- Penalty
- Initial $2,800 · Current $2,240 Reduced
General-duty citation text
29 CFR 1910.147(c)(7)(i): The employer did not provide adequate training to ensure that the purpose and function of the energy control program was understood by employees: At 6415 Richmond Ave. Houston, TX; training was not provided to employees to ensure that they understood the purpose and function of the energy control program, exposing employees to struck by hazards.

1910.147 C06 I
- Issued
- Dec 18, 2014
- Abate by
- Dec 31, 2014
- Penalty
- Initial $1,000 · Current $800 Reduced
General-duty citation text
29 CFR 1910.147(c)(6)(i): The employer did not conduct a periodic inspection of the energy control procedure at least annually to ensure that the procedure and the requirement of this standard were being followed: At 6415 Richmond Ave. Houston, TX; periodic inspections of energy control procedures were not conducted, exposing employees to struck by hazards.
